Output d9bc54c185b256a6ddc81837ca3957113c416354cfda3028c1f4fc350fb12264:4

value
20935632658
script pubkey
OP_0 OP_PUSHBYTES_20 6dc50ac5823ebb46a76a348b146ea03409f70f0c
address
tb1qdhzs43vz86a5dfm2xj93gm4qxsylwrcv7ug4ry
transaction
d9bc54c185b256a6ddc81837ca3957113c416354cfda3028c1f4fc350fb12264
confirmations
61520
spent
true